CLEANSED, dir. Krzysztof Warlikowski

 

 

Translation: Krzysztof Warlikowski, Jacek Poniedzialek

Director: Krzysztof Warlikowski

Set design: Malgorzata Szczesniak

Music: Pawel Mykietyn

Lighting director: Felice Ross (Israel)

 

Cast:

Ewa Dalkowska, Renate Jett (Austria), Malgorzata Hajewska-Krzysztofik, Mariusz Bonaszewski, Redbad Klijnstra, Jacek Poniedzialek, Thomas Schweiberer, Tomasz Tyndyk, Fabian Wlodarek

 

Co-production: Wroclawski Teatr Wspolczesny, Teatr Polski w Poznaniu, TR Warszawa, Hebbel Theater w Berlinie, THEOREM and Europejska Komisja Kultury.

 

This famous performance was originally created in 2001 and was the first Polish adaptation of Sarah Kane’s drama with such artistic scale and force. Warlikowski explores love in its various aspects – loneliness, suffering, heroic faithfulness, lack of acceptance, and unfulfilled longings.

 

Superb cast and unique stage design make it a complete sell-out each time the production appears in programmes. Bonaszewski, “using simple yet refined ways of expression, plays an almost gentle, but striking in his brutality, monster,” writes Teresa Wilniewczyc (Notatnik Teatralny 2002/26). Janusz Majcherek, describing Celinska’s outstanding, committed performance, admits that “[…] this is not just devotion, this is self-sacrifice or even – and I’m not afraid to say it – some kind of a new total act” (Teatr 2002/1-2).
